Evolution of the capacity of container ships:1968-2022

YearName of container shipCountry of manufactureShipownerCapacity in TEU
2022Ever AriaTaiwanEvergreen Marine Corporation24 004
2021Ever AlpTaiwanEvergreen Marine Corporation23 992
2020HMM AlgecirasSouth KoreaHyundai Merchant Marine23 964
2017OOCL Hong KongSouth KoreaOrient Overseas Container Line21 413
2015MSC OscarSouth KoreaMediterranean Shipping CompanyMore than 19 000
2013Maersk Mc-Kinney MøllerSouth KoreaAP Moller-Maersk18 270
2012Marco Polo (CMA CGM)South KoreaCMA CGM groupMore than 16 000
2006Emma MaerskDenmarkAP Moller-MaerskMore than 11 000
2005Gjertrud MaerskDenmarkAP Moller-MaerskMore than 10 000
2003Anna MaerskDenmarkAP Moller-MaerskMore than 9 000
2002Charlotte MaerskDenmarkAP Moller-Maersk8 890
1997Susan MaerskDenmarkAP Moller-MaerskMore than 8 000
1996Regina MaerskDenmarkAP Moller-Maersk6 400
1984American New YorkUnited StatesUnited States Lines4 600
1980Neptune GarnetUnited KingdomNeptune Orient Lines4 100
1972Hamburg ExpressGermanyHapag-Lloyd AG2 950
1968Encounter BayGermanyScottish Shire Line1 530
